Georgia General Assembly · SB 284 · Senate Date Signed by Governor (Act 377)

"Georgia Uniform Securities Act of 2008,"; issuance of orders by the Commissioner of Securities directing persons who have violated certain securities provisions to return; authorize

Officially: “A BILL to be entitled an Act to amend Chapter 5 of Title 10 of the Official Code of Georgia Annotated, the "Georgia Uniform Securities Act of 2008," so as to authorize the issuance of orders by the Commissioner of Securities directing persons who have violated certain securities provisions to...
